8358953148 is an even composite number. It is composed of six dist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of two hundred sixteen divisors.

Prime factorization of 8358953148:

22 × 32 × 7 × 13 × 592 × 733

(2 × 2 × 3 × 3 × 7 × 13 × 59 × 59 × 733)
